Output 928dca86fac5478d84f4e9ffa1b95f87c8eac715e9b80cb2fef3d9af4c60b2bf:0

value
19697079
script pubkey
OP_0 OP_PUSHBYTES_20 cdf76d68cbec5b6e1744e58742ecd3489d282b94
address
bc1qehmk66xta3dku96yukr59mxnfzwjs2u5xfl9uk
transaction
928dca86fac5478d84f4e9ffa1b95f87c8eac715e9b80cb2fef3d9af4c60b2bf
confirmations
38837
spent
true